Home
last modified time | relevance | path

Searched refs:tracker (Results 1 – 25 of 48) sorted by relevance

12

/freebsd/sys/kern/
H A Dkern_rmlock.c125 struct rm_priotracker *tracker; in lock_rm() local
131 tracker = (struct rm_priotracker *)how; in lock_rm()
132 rm_rlock(rm, tracker); in lock_rm()
143 struct rm_priotracker *tracker; in unlock_rm() local
147 tracker = NULL; in unlock_rm()
163 tracker = (struct rm_priotracker *)queue; in unlock_rm()
164 if ((tracker->rmp_rmlock == rm) && in unlock_rm()
165 (tracker->rmp_thread == td)) { in unlock_rm()
166 how = (uintptr_t)tracker; in unlock_rm()
170 KASSERT(tracker != NULL, in unlock_rm()
[all …]
H A Dkern_osd.c205 struct rm_priotracker tracker; in osd_set_reserved() local
210 rm_rlock(&osdm[type].osd_object_lock, &tracker); in osd_set_reserved()
220 rm_runlock(&osdm[type].osd_object_lock, &tracker); in osd_set_reserved()
246 &tracker); in osd_set_reserved()
268 rm_runlock(&osdm[type].osd_object_lock, &tracker); in osd_set_reserved()
301 struct rm_priotracker tracker; in osd_get() local
307 rm_rlock(&osdm[type].osd_object_lock, &tracker); in osd_get()
309 rm_runlock(&osdm[type].osd_object_lock, &tracker); in osd_get()
316 struct rm_priotracker tracker; in osd_del() local
318 rm_rlock(&osdm[type].osd_object_lock, &tracker); in osd_del()
[all …]
H A Dkern_sysctl.c107 #define SYSCTL_RLOCK(tracker) rm_rlock(&sysctllock, (tracker)) argument
108 #define SYSCTL_RUNLOCK(tracker) rm_runlock(&sysctllock, (tracker)) argument
180 struct sysctl_req *req, struct rm_priotracker *tracker) in sysctl_root_handler_locked() argument
187 if (tracker != NULL) in sysctl_root_handler_locked()
188 SYSCTL_RUNLOCK(tracker); in sysctl_root_handler_locked()
206 if (tracker != NULL) in sysctl_root_handler_locked()
207 SYSCTL_RLOCK(tracker); in sysctl_root_handler_locked()
433 struct rm_priotracker tracker; in sysctl_reuse_test() local
1165 struct rm_priotracker tracker; sysctl_sysctl_debug() local
1189 struct rm_priotracker tracker; sysctl_sysctl_name() local
1408 struct rm_priotracker tracker; sysctl_sysctl_next() local
1475 struct rm_priotracker tracker; sysctl_sysctl_name2oid() local
1522 struct rm_priotracker tracker; sysctl_sysctl_oidfmt() local
1554 struct rm_priotracker tracker; sysctl_sysctl_oiddescr() local
1583 struct rm_priotracker tracker; sysctl_sysctl_oidlabel() local
2312 struct rm_priotracker tracker; sysctl_root() local
[all...]
H A Dkern_ucoredump.c217 struct rm_priotracker tracker; in coredump() local
252 rm_rlock(&coredump_rmlock, &tracker); in coredump()
289 rm_runlock(&coredump_rmlock, &tracker); in coredump()
H A Dkern_procctl.c331 reap_kill_sched(struct reap_kill_tracker_head *tracker, struct proc *p2) in reap_kill_sched() argument
344 TAILQ_INSERT_TAIL(tracker, t, link); in reap_kill_sched()
388 struct reap_kill_tracker_head tracker; in reap_kill_subtree_once() local
395 TAILQ_INIT(&tracker); in reap_kill_subtree_once()
396 reap_kill_sched(&tracker, reaper); in reap_kill_subtree_once()
397 while ((t = TAILQ_FIRST(&tracker)) != NULL) { in reap_kill_subtree_once()
398 TAILQ_REMOVE(&tracker, t, link); in reap_kill_subtree_once()
418 reap_kill_sched(&tracker, p2); in reap_kill_subtree_once()
/freebsd/sys/sys/
H A Drmlock.h59 int _rm_rlock_debug(struct rmlock *rm, struct rm_priotracker *tracker,
61 void _rm_runlock_debug(struct rmlock *rm, struct rm_priotracker *tracker,
66 int _rm_rlock(struct rmlock *rm, struct rm_priotracker *tracker,
68 void _rm_runlock(struct rmlock *rm, struct rm_priotracker *tracker);
84 #define rm_rlock(rm,tracker) \ argument
85 ((void)_rm_rlock_debug((rm),(tracker), 0, LOCK_FILE, LOCK_LINE ))
86 #define rm_try_rlock(rm,tracker) \ argument
87 _rm_rlock_debug((rm),(tracker), 1, LOCK_FILE, LOCK_LINE )
88 #define rm_runlock(rm,tracker) \ argument
89 _rm_runlock_debug((rm), (tracker), LOCK_FILE, LOCK_LINE )
[all …]
/freebsd/sys/security/mac/
H A Dmac_internal.h204 void mac_policy_slock_nosleep(struct rm_priotracker *tracker);
206 void mac_policy_sunlock_nosleep(struct rm_priotracker *tracker);
334 struct rm_priotracker tracker; \
336 mac_policy_slock_nosleep(&tracker); \
343 mac_policy_sunlock_nosleep(&tracker); \
365 struct rm_priotracker tracker; \
367 mac_policy_slock_nosleep(&tracker); \
375 mac_policy_sunlock_nosleep(&tracker); \
415 struct rm_priotracker tracker; \
417 mac_policy_slock_nosleep(&tracker); \
[all …]
H A Dmac_framework.c228 mac_policy_slock_nosleep(struct rm_priotracker *tracker) in mac_policy_slock_nosleep() argument
235 rm_rlock(&mac_policy_rm, tracker); in mac_policy_slock_nosleep()
255 mac_policy_sunlock_nosleep(struct rm_priotracker *tracker) in mac_policy_sunlock_nosleep() argument
262 rm_runlock(&mac_policy_rm, tracker); in mac_policy_sunlock_nosleep()
/freebsd/sys/net/
H A Dnetisr.c123 #define NETISR_RLOCK(tracker) rm_rlock(&netisr_rmlock, (tracker)) argument
124 #define NETISR_RUNLOCK(tracker) rm_runlock(&netisr_rmlock, (tracker)) argument
512 struct rm_priotracker tracker; in netisr_getqdrops()
526 NETISR_RLOCK(&tracker); in netisr_getqdrops()
535 NETISR_RUNLOCK(&tracker); in netisr_getqdrops()
544 struct rm_priotracker tracker; in netisr_getqlimit()
557 NETISR_RLOCK(&tracker); in netisr_getqlimit()
562 NETISR_RUNLOCK(&tracker); in netisr_getqlimit()
513 struct rm_priotracker tracker; netisr_getqdrops() local
545 struct rm_priotracker tracker; netisr_getqlimit() local
949 struct rm_priotracker tracker; swi_net() local
1059 struct rm_priotracker tracker; netisr_queue_src() local
1111 struct rm_priotracker tracker; netisr_dispatch_src() local
1375 struct rm_priotracker tracker; sysctl_netisr_proto() local
1425 struct rm_priotracker tracker; sysctl_netisr_workstream() local
1477 struct rm_priotracker tracker; sysctl_netisr_work() local
[all...]
H A Dif_vxlan.c639 struct rm_priotracker *tracker) in vxlan_ftable_update_locked() argument
660 VXLAN_RUNLOCK(sc, tracker); in vxlan_ftable_update_locked()
670 VXLAN_RUNLOCK(sc, tracker); in vxlan_ftable_update_locked()
698 struct rm_priotracker tracker; in vxlan_ftable_learn() local
715 VXLAN_RLOCK(sc, &tracker); in vxlan_ftable_learn()
716 error = vxlan_ftable_update_locked(sc, &vxlsa, mac, &tracker); in vxlan_ftable_learn()
717 VXLAN_UNLOCK(sc, &tracker); in vxlan_ftable_learn()
725 struct rm_priotracker tracker; in vxlan_ftable_sysctl_dump() local
743 VXLAN_RLOCK(sc, &tracker); in vxlan_ftable_sysctl_dump()
751 VXLAN_RUNLOCK(sc, &tracker); in vxlan_ftable_sysctl_dump()
[all …]
/freebsd/sys/cddl/contrib/opensolaris/uts/powerpc/dtrace/
H A Dfasttrap_isa.c270 struct rm_priotracker tracker; in fasttrap_return_common() local
275 rm_rlock(&fasttrap_tp_lock, &tracker); in fasttrap_return_common()
290 rm_runlock(&fasttrap_tp_lock, &tracker); in fasttrap_return_common()
308 rm_runlock(&fasttrap_tp_lock, &tracker); in fasttrap_return_common()
338 struct rm_priotracker tracker; in fasttrap_pid_probe() local
373 rm_rlock(&fasttrap_tp_lock, &tracker); in fasttrap_pid_probe()
392 rm_runlock(&fasttrap_tp_lock, &tracker); in fasttrap_pid_probe()
446 rm_runlock(&fasttrap_tp_lock, &tracker); in fasttrap_pid_probe()
/freebsd/sys/dev/mlx4/mlx4_core/
H A Dmlx4_resource_tracker.c950 struct mlx4_resource_tracker *tracker = &priv->mfunc.master.res_tracker; in handle_unexisting_counter() local
958 &tracker->slave_list[slave].res_list[RES_COUNTER], in handle_unexisting_counter()
1182 struct mlx4_resource_tracker *tracker = &priv->mfunc.master.res_tracker; in mlx4_calc_vf_counters() local
1197 &tracker->slave_list[slave].res_list[RES_COUNTER], in mlx4_calc_vf_counters()
1232 struct mlx4_resource_tracker *tracker = &priv->mfunc.master.res_tracker; in add_res_range() local
1233 struct rb_root *root = &tracker->res_tree[type]; in add_res_range()
1260 &tracker->slave_list[slave].res_list[type]); in add_res_range()
1418 struct mlx4_resource_tracker *tracker = &priv->mfunc.master.res_tracker; in rem_res_range() local
1423 r = res_tracker_lookup(&tracker->res_tree[type], i); in rem_res_range()
1438 r = res_tracker_lookup(&tracker->res_tree[type], i); in rem_res_range()
[all …]
/freebsd/sys/netinet/
H A Dtcp_stats.c187 struct rm_priotracker tracker; in tcp_stats_sample_rollthedice() local
193 rm_rlock(&tcp_stats_tpl_sampling_lock, &tracker); in tcp_stats_sample_rollthedice()
196 rm_runlock(&tcp_stats_tpl_sampling_lock, &tracker); in tcp_stats_sample_rollthedice()
/freebsd/sys/dev/mlx5/mlx5_accel/
H A Dmlx5_ipsec.c332 struct rm_priotracker tracker; in mlx5e_if_sa_newkey_onedir() local
348 ipsec_sahtree_rlock(&tracker); in mlx5e_if_sa_newkey_onedir()
352 ipsec_sahtree_runlock(&tracker); in mlx5e_if_sa_newkey_onedir()
369 ipsec_sahtree_rlock(&tracker); in mlx5e_if_sa_newkey_onedir()
374 ipsec_sahtree_runlock(&tracker); in mlx5e_if_sa_newkey_onedir()
380 ipsec_sahtree_runlock(&tracker); in mlx5e_if_sa_newkey_onedir()
/freebsd/sys/cddl/contrib/opensolaris/uts/intel/dtrace/
H A Dfasttrap_isa.c692 struct rm_priotracker tracker; in fasttrap_return_common() local
694 rm_rlock(&fasttrap_tp_lock, &tracker); in fasttrap_return_common()
709 rm_runlock(&fasttrap_tp_lock, &tracker); in fasttrap_return_common()
730 rm_runlock(&fasttrap_tp_lock, &tracker); in fasttrap_return_common()
923 struct rm_priotracker tracker; in fasttrap_pid_probe() local
989 rm_rlock(&fasttrap_tp_lock, &tracker); in fasttrap_pid_probe()
1008 rm_runlock(&fasttrap_tp_lock, &tracker); in fasttrap_pid_probe()
1149 rm_runlock(&fasttrap_tp_lock, &tracker); in fasttrap_pid_probe()
/freebsd/contrib/elftoolchain/
H A DREADME.rst108 Please use our `bug tracker`_ for viewing existing bug reports and
111 .. _`bug tracker`: https://sourceforge.net/p/elftoolchain/tickets/
/freebsd/sys/contrib/openzfs/.github/ISSUE_TEMPLATE/
H A Dfeature_request.md13 Please check our issue tracker before opening a new feature request.
H A Dbug_report.md15 *IMPORTANT* - Please check our issue tracker before opening a new issue.
/freebsd/sys/dev/thunderbolt/
H A Dnhi.c619 r->tracker = trkr; in nhi_alloc_ring0()
844 nhi_intr(r->tracker); in nhi_tx_synchronous()
890 txpdf = &r->tracker->txpdf[sof]; in nhi_tx_complete()
920 rxpdf = &r->tracker->rxpdf[eof]; in nhi_rx_complete()
943 trkr = rp->tracker; in nhi_register_pdf()
999 trkr = rp->tracker; in nhi_deregister_pdf()
/freebsd/sys/contrib/openzfs/contrib/debian/
H A Dcopyright19 [1] https://tracker.debian.org/pkg/zfs-linux
/freebsd/contrib/libyaml/
H A DReadMe.md37 tracker](https://github.com/yaml/libyaml/issues/new).
/freebsd/contrib/libpcap/
H A DCONTRIBUTING.md6 the bug tracker!
/freebsd/sys/contrib/openzfs/.github/
H A DCONTRIBUTING.md64 support requests on the GitHub issue tracker.
74 tracker](https://github.com/openzfs/zfs/issues) *first* to ensure the
79 tracker](https://github.com/openzfs/zfs/issues).
116 by filtering the issue tracker by the ["Type: Feature"
/freebsd/contrib/googletest/
H A DCONTRIBUTING.md31 [issue tracker](https://github.com/google/googletest/issues).
34 have a corresponding issue in the issue tracker, please create one.
/freebsd/contrib/libcbor/doc/source/
H A Dgetting_started.rst107 report them to the `issue tracker <https://github.com/PJK/libcbor/issues>`_.
193 …99 yet the compilation has failed, please report the issue to the `issue tracker <https://github.c…

12